About Warrendale Charter Academy

Warrendale Charter Academy is a public elementary school in Detroit, MI, part of Warrendale Charter Academy. Warrendale Charter Academy serves approximately 676 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-8th, and has a 21.8:1 student-teacher ratio. Warrendale Charter Academy has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.9 out of 10 and ranks #2,531 of 3,192 schools in MI.

Structured state assessment records for Warrendale Charter Academy show 22%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 34%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

Warrendale Charter Academy runs 21.8: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.

Warrendale Charter Academy is a charter school: publicly funded, but run with more independence than a traditional district school. Many charters are built around a specific model or focus, so it's worth understanding this one's mission, how enrollment works, and how it differs from the district schools nearby.

70% of students at Warrendale Charter Academy were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
